STONE HOUSE IN STANCIJA 1904 NEAR SVETVINČENAT

ISTRIADUCTION In May | Weekend | Free Entrance Welcome! A stone house was built in 1904 by the family Modrušan, in the village of Smoljanci near the renaissance town of Svetvinčenat. Two Modrušan brothers had many family members. Everybody was working hard and was taking care of the domestic animals, as pigs and goats. Also built in 1904, is the private residence and šterna (water tank), that represents a prime example of traditional Istrian architecture. In the past, the local villagers went to take water from the water tank. The water tank was at the time a precious good that only rich families could afford. We (family Moll) bought and renovated the stone house in 1999 till 2003. Stancija 1904, located in the idyllic village of Smoljanci is located in the heart of Istria. The word “Stancija” means newly-renovated and fully-equipped traditional Istrian accommodation surrounded by untouched nature. ROČ USED TO BE IMPORTANT CROATIAN LITERACY,PRINTING AND PUBLISHING CENTRES-BASED ON THE OLDEST CROATIAN ALPHABET,GLAGOLJICA

ISTRIADUCTION  All Year | Working time: 0-24h | Free Entrance Roč was established in prehistoric times as a settlement. The fortification was built in the Middle Ages and was mentioned for the first time in a written document in 1064. From the 12th to 15th century Roč developed into an urban settlement. Until 20th century Roč was one of the most important Croatian literacy, printing and publishing centres-based on the oldest Croatian alphabet, called „glagoljica“. In Roč the first Croatian printed book Milas from 1483 was prepared for printing according Duke Novaks Missla from 1368, which has kept in Nugla at that time. Hence, in Roč Tourist office there is a replica of Gutenbergs printing press. RAILWAY STATION – PULA

ISTRIADUCTION  All Year | Working time: as per schedule | Ticket Railway station Pula build in 1876 was under the authority of Austria, Italy and Slovenia until 1991. when they are under the Croatia Railway. It was connected with local shipyard Uljanik in 1878., 1,3 km of railway. The traffic was significantly increase and in 1884. it was transported over 34t of cargo. Railway was very good connected with Trieste and Vienna. There was also a „green train“ to Slovenia. In 1904. Pula Railway Station was connected with city center with tram. ŽBEVNICA HIKING

ISTRIADUCTION  All Year | No Working time | Free Entrance Žbevnica is situated in north Istria peninsula on Ćićarija mountain. There are many ups and downs and some of them are very steep so count to hike on some sections. Hike starts in the village called Brest. Maybe fifty meters to the east has located a road to our goal-Žbevnica mountain. The first step became a mountain hut (Žbevnica 851 meters). That's a wonderful place to have a little break and shoot some photos and sight a valley under the Ćićarija. After the break, we continue to climb another 20 minutes to the Žbevnica. The path is well marked. Coming on the top view is simply amazing. From the top you can see the Slovenian mountains, the city of Kopar and the Italian Dolomites. Of course, a big part of our beautiful Istria is like on the plate. You can see Mirna valley, Motovun, Buzet section, Učka mountain and more. The top is high 1014 meters.
